This video is the 6th Video in the series partitioning in oracle.
It explains the different composite partitioning approaches and in what scenario they should be used with real project use case explanations.

Thank you for your very informative videos 🙏. I have a problem statement and I would like to hear your opinions on it. Problem Statement: I have a transaction table with 1 Billion Rows per Month (Approx. 50 GB/month). I will have aggregation of transactions for a specific user_id and a date range. The aggregation can be like 1. Aggregate per Day for a Week 2. Aggregate per Day for a Month 3. Aggregate per Month for an year. So my query will always a "user_id" and timestamp > start_date and timestamp < end_date. Also, I need to retain the data for 3 years. So, I'm exploring which partitioning strategy to opt for and the below is my understanding. 1. Range Partitioning (INTERVAL= EVERY 1 DAY): Pros: - Easy maintenance as Data purging is easier Cons: - Since the query can have a date range for a week(7 partitions), a month(30 partitions) or an year(365 partitions), will this impact the query performance as I need to aggregate over multiple partitions? 2. Hash Partitioning (partition key by user_id, NUM Partitions = 128 partitions): Pros: - All data for a specific user will be in the same partition and hence can query performance would be better Cons: - Might result in Skewed data as the partitioning is based on user_id and not transaction_id - Difficulty in purging as the old data is spread across multiple partitions. 3. Range-Hash Partitioning (INTERVAL= EVERY 1 MONTH, Sub-partition by user id with 32 partitions) Pros: - Benefits of Range Partitioning (Easier Maintenance) - Most of my queries will be for weekly or monthly and hence most of the time the query should find the data in the same segment Cons: - Will it have any impact if I have to query for an year and aggregate monthly? 4. Hash-Range Partitioning (Partition by user with 32 partitions, sub-partition by Range(INTERVAL= EVERY 1 MONTH)) -- I have no clue how this can be different from Range-Hash Partitioning. Kindly share your opinion and help me in taking this decision. Thanks, Moin
